Laparoscopy for endometriosis diagnosis?

I am scheduled to get a laparoscopy for diagnosis and fulguration of endometriosis. I wanted to know from start to finish how long does it take to do the procedure from start to finish like going home if surgery is at 12:30 pm.

Female | 44 years old

3 Answers

Usually 1 to 2 hrs. Depends on how much of endometrial implants you have.
It depends on what is found during the procedure and there may be ablation and excision during the procedure. It can take 6-8 hours and you may have to be admitted. Additionally, endometriosis is a clinical diagnosis. There is Stage 0 disease, where nothing is seen on laparoscopy but the patient still has endometriosis.
